Isi artikelThe present study examined the utility of coping congruency and the average level of couple coping, in explaining adjustment to multiple sclerosis (MS) in care receiver-carer dyads. Forty-five dyads were interviewed and completed questionnaires at Time 1 and 12 months later; Time 2. Dependent variables included Time 2 collective distress and individual adjustment. Predictors included Time 1 illness, caregiving, and coping variables. Findings support the utility of both the coping congruence and average level of couple coping concepts in explaining collective and individual adjustment in care receiver-carer dyads
